Abstract

The utility model discloses a manual positioning and pressing device, which comprises a base, a connecting plate vertically connected with the base, a push-pull clamp connected with the connecting plate, and a positioning block passing through the base, wherein the push-pull clamp consists of a push-pull rod, a slide rod and a mounting seat, the push-pull rod is hinged with one end of the slide rod, the push-pull rod passes through the mounting seat, one end of the push-pull rod is hinged with the mounting seat, and the problems that the device is too slow in fastening and clamping a workpiece, inaccurate in positioning and insufficient in strength of a clamp are solved; the positioning is accurate, the formability of the welding line is good, the process defects are obviously reduced, the welding speed is improved, and the strength of the clamp is greatly improved.

Technical Field
The utility model relates to a product welding jig device, more specifically relates to manual positioning closing device.
Background
In the welding production process, the welding clamp is a clamp adopted for ensuring the size of a weldment, improving the assembly precision and efficiency and preventing welding deformation, so that the correct relative positions of parts can be ensured during assembly positioning welding, the welding deformation of a workpiece can be prevented or reduced, especially during batch production, the welding quality can be stabilized, the size deviation of an explosion piece is reduced, the interchangability of products is ensured, and the manual welding clamp is a clamp for manually positioning and clamping the workpiece, and is widely applied to industrial processing of mechanical engineering. At present, the existing manual positioning and pressing device has certain defects in use, the speed of fastening and clamping workpieces is too low, the positioning is not accurate, the strength of a clamp is not enough, other areas which do not need to be welded are easily affected due to operation in the welding process, certain influence is caused on welded parts, and the labor efficiency and the labor time of workers are greatly increased.

SUMMERY OF THE UTILITY MODEL
The utility model discloses to the problem that exists among the prior art, provide manual positioning closing device, solved the device fastening and press from both sides tight work piece speed too slow, the location is not accurate, the not enough problem of intensity of anchor clamps.
The utility model adopts the technical proposal that:
the manual positioning and compressing device comprises a base, a connecting plate vertically connected with the base, a push-pull clamp connected with the connecting plate, and a positioning block penetrating through the base, wherein the push-pull clamp comprises a push-pull rod, a sliding rod and a mounting seat, the push-pull rod is hinged with one end of the sliding rod, the push-pull rod penetrates through the mounting seat, and one end of the push-pull rod is hinged with the mounting seat.
Furthermore, a reinforcing rib is arranged between the connecting plate and the base, the reinforcing rib enhances the stability of the joint of the connecting plate and the base, and the deformation of the device is prevented.
Furthermore, one side of the reinforcing rib is connected with the connecting plate, and the other side of the reinforcing rib is connected with the base.
Furthermore, the bottom of the base contains a pattern hole which is locked on the tool.
Furthermore, the base comprises a positioning hole, the positioning block penetrates through the positioning hole, the workpiece is positioned at the best welding position through the positioning block, and positioning is accurate.
Further, the positioning block is provided with a handle.
Furthermore, the mounting base contains a plurality of threaded holes which are locked on the connecting plate.
Furthermore, a bolt is arranged at one end, far away from the mounting seat, of the sliding rod and used for adjusting the distance.
Furthermore, the push-pull rod is hinged with one end of the sliding rod through two hinge pieces.
Furthermore, a sliding groove is formed in the mounting seat, and the sliding rod penetrates through the sliding groove.
Compared with the prior art, the beneficial effects of the utility model are that:
the push-pull type quick clamp can meet the requirements of various positioning and clamping forms, so that the push-pull type quick clamp is suitable for various parts, and has the function of quickly fastening and clamping a workpiece no matter the push-pull type quick clamp is pushed forwards to a proper position and props the workpiece or pulled backwards to a proper position and pulls the workpiece; the positioning block enables the workpiece to be positioned at the best welding position, the positioning is accurate, the formability of a welding seam is good, the process defects are obviously reduced, and the welding speed is improved; the strengthening rib has strengthened the stability of connecting plate with the base junction, prevents that the device from warping.

Example 1
The manual positioning and pressing device comprises a base 1, a positioning block 2, a connecting plate 3, a reinforcing rib 4 and a push-pull type clamp 5.
The base 1 is vertically connected with the connecting plate 3, and the bottom of the base 1 is internally provided with a grain hole which is locked on a tool.
Be equipped with strengthening rib 4 between connecting plate 3 and the base 1, strengthening rib 4 is connected with connecting plate 3 on one side, and the another side is connected with base 1, and strengthening rib 4 has strengthened the stability of connecting plate 3 with base 1 junction, and the prevention device warp.
The base 1 comprises a positioning hole, the positioning block 2 penetrates through the positioning hole, the positioning hole is used for movably positioning the positioning block 2 and can slide, the positioning block 2 is provided with a handle 6, the handle 6 is connected with one end of the positioning block 2, the handle 6 can push and pull the positioning block 2, the positioning block 2 enables a workpiece to be located at the best welding position, positioning is accurate, welding seams are good in formability, technological defects are obviously reduced, and welding speed is improved.
The push-pull type clamp 5 comprises a push-pull rod 7, a slide rod 8 and a mounting seat 9, the mounting seat 9 is connected with a connecting plate 3, the connecting plate 3 is provided with more than one screw mounting hole, one end of the push-pull rod 7 is hinged with one end of the slide rod 8 through two hinge pieces, the push-pull rod 7 penetrates through the mounting seat 9, one end of the push-pull rod 7 is hinged with the mounting seat 9, one end of the slide rod 8, far away from the mounting seat 9, is provided with a bolt, can adjust distance and can be used for welding, and the like, so that the push-pull type clamp is rapidly clamped and opened in machine tool processing, and the push-pull type clamp is suitable for occasions with fast production rhythm and high product processing precision; a sliding groove is formed in the mounting seat 9, the sliding rod 8 penetrates through the sliding groove, and a plurality of threaded holes are contained in the base of the mounting seat 9 and locked on the connecting plate 3; the push-pull type clamp 5 can meet the requirements of various positioning and clamping forms, so the push-pull type clamp is suitable for various parts, the push-pull type clamp 5 has the function of quickly fastening and clamping a workpiece no matter the push-pull type clamp 5 is pushed forwards to a proper position and props against the workpiece or pulled backwards to a proper position and pull the workpiece, and the strength of the push-pull type clamp 5 is also greatly improved.
